BirdLife Malta said this afternoon “that following the Government’s decision at the start of the week to draft in AFM soldiers to reinforce the police against the onslaught of illegal hunting and trapping during the first two weeks of the season, yesterday two men were again photographed hunting inside a protected area.”
BLM said that “this time the two hunters were seen hunting inside the Ghadira Nature Reserve protected zone, a buffer zone around the protected wetland reserve which extends the Bird Sanctuary to prevent hunters from targeting birds around the reserve.”
The incident was reported to the ALE and the location of the last whereabouts of the two men was pointed out. BLM said that ALE officers went to search for the men, “but it is not known whether they were apprehended.”
